编程背景拖影问题可以通过以下方法解决:
使用CSS属性实现
通过设置元素的阴影属性,如`box-shadow`,调整阴影的模糊度和偏移量,来模拟背景拖影的效果。
使用JavaScript或动画库
捕捉元素的移动事件,在移动过程中逐渐改变元素的样式,从而产生背景拖影的效果。这种方式可以更灵活地控制拖影效果的细节,但需要编写一定的代码逻辑。
图形库和框架
使用各种图形库和框架来实现背景拖影效果,例如在网页设计中可以使用CSS的`box-shadow`属性,在游戏开发中可以使用图形引擎的特殊效果功能,如阴影映射技术或阴影体积渲染技术。
升级软件和驱动程序
如果问题出现在特定软件如UG软件中,可以尝试升级到最新版本,调整视图设置和图形卡设置,确保显卡驱动程序是最新的,并且硬件加速已启用。
调整图形质量设置
降低UG软件的图形质量设置,减少显卡的负荷,从而减少拖影问题的发生。
检查计算机硬件
确保计算机硬件,特别是显卡,运行正常且散热良好。过热可能导致显卡性能下降,从而引发拖影问题。
根据具体的应用场景和需求,可以选择合适的方法来解决编程中的背景拖影问题。